..
Address.cpp
Moved lldb::user_id_t values to be 64 bit. This was going to be needed for
2011-10-19 18:09:39 +00:00
AddressRange.cpp
Update declarations for all functions/methods that accept printf-style
2011-09-20 21:44:10 +00:00
AddressResolver.cpp
Initial checkin of lldb code from internal Apple repo.
2010-06-08 16:52:24 +00:00
AddressResolverFileLine.cpp
Added a new option to the "source list" command that allows us to see where
2011-04-19 04:19:37 +00:00
AddressResolverName.cpp
Removed namespace qualification from symbol queries.
2011-10-13 16:49:47 +00:00
ArchSpec.cpp
The first part of a fix for being able to select an architecture slice from
2011-09-21 03:57:31 +00:00
Baton.cpp
Don't print out the baton pointer value for simple Baton classes.
2011-06-21 20:47:20 +00:00
Broadcaster.cpp
Cleaned up the the code that figures out the inlined stack frames given a
2011-10-01 00:45:15 +00:00
Communication.cpp
Fixed an issue where even if the communication object had Clear() called on
2011-08-19 23:28:37 +00:00
Connection.cpp
Initial checkin of lldb code from internal Apple repo.
2010-06-08 16:52:24 +00:00
ConnectionFileDescriptor.cpp
Add support for platforms without sa_len to SocketAddress, and modify
2011-07-22 19:12:42 +00:00
ConnectionMachPort.cpp
Improved the packet throughput when debugging with GDB remote by over 3x on
2011-06-17 01:22:15 +00:00
ConnectionSharedMemory.cpp
Improved the packet throughput when debugging with GDB remote by over 3x on
2011-06-17 01:22:15 +00:00
ConstString.cpp
Fixed up the comments in the headerdoc to match the current implementation
2011-09-12 03:55:58 +00:00
DataBufferHeap.cpp
Initial checkin of lldb code from internal Apple repo.
2010-06-08 16:52:24 +00:00
DataBufferMemoryMap.cpp
Switch to using the S_ISDIR and S_ISREG sys/stat.h macros in
2011-07-08 00:38:03 +00:00
DataEncoder.cpp
Forgot to write out the NULL terminator when putting C string value into
2011-09-01 18:13:54 +00:00
DataExtractor.cpp
Fix preprocessor warnings for no newline at the end of the source files.
2011-10-12 00:53:29 +00:00
DataVisualization.cpp
Renaming a bulk of method calls from Get() to something more descriptive
2011-09-09 23:33:14 +00:00
Debugger.cpp
Moved lldb::user_id_t values to be 64 bit. This was going to be needed for
2011-10-19 18:09:39 +00:00
Disassembler.cpp
Added ClangNamespaceDecl * parameters to several
2011-10-12 02:08:07 +00:00
DynamicLoader.cpp
The DynamicLoader plug-in instance now lives up in lldb_private::Process where
2011-02-16 04:46:07 +00:00
EmulateInstruction.cpp
Created a std::string in the base StopInfo class for the description and
2011-06-04 01:26:29 +00:00
Error.cpp
Python summary strings:
2011-07-15 02:26:42 +00:00
Event.cpp
This patch captures and serializes all output being written by the
2011-05-02 20:41:46 +00:00
FileLineResolver.cpp
Added the ability to restrict breakpoints by function name, function regexp, selector
2011-09-23 00:54:11 +00:00
FileSpecList.cpp
Added the ability to restrict breakpoints by function name, function regexp, selector
2011-09-23 00:54:11 +00:00
FormatClasses.cpp
Fix preprocessor warnings for no newline at the end of the source files.
2011-10-12 00:53:29 +00:00
FormatManager.cpp
Fix preprocessor warnings for no newline at the end of the source files.
2011-10-12 00:53:29 +00:00
History.cpp
I modified the StringMap that was being used to unique our debugger C strings
2011-06-09 22:34:34 +00:00
InputReader.cpp
While tracking down memory consumption issue a few things were needed: the
2011-08-10 02:10:13 +00:00
InputReaderEZ.cpp
While tracking down memory consumption issue a few things were needed: the
2011-08-10 02:10:13 +00:00
InputReaderStack.cpp
Create new class, InputReaderStack, to better handle
2011-06-02 19:18:55 +00:00
Language.cpp
Created lldb::LanguageType by moving an enumeration from the
2010-07-28 02:04:09 +00:00
Listener.cpp
Cleaned up the the code that figures out the inlined stack frames given a
2011-10-01 00:45:15 +00:00
Log.cpp
Update declarations for all functions/methods that accept printf-style
2011-09-20 21:44:10 +00:00
Makefile
Merged Eli Friedman's linux build changes where he added Makefile files that
2010-07-09 20:39:50 +00:00
Mangled.cpp
I modified the StringMap that was being used to unique our debugger C strings
2011-06-09 22:34:34 +00:00
Module.cpp
Removed namespace qualification from symbol queries.
2011-10-13 16:49:47 +00:00
ModuleChild.cpp
Initial checkin of lldb code from internal Apple repo.
2010-06-08 16:52:24 +00:00
ModuleList.cpp
Removed namespace qualification from symbol queries.
2011-10-13 16:49:47 +00:00
Opcode.cpp
Added more functionality to the public API to allow for better
2011-09-26 07:11:27 +00:00
PluginManager.cpp
Added a new plug-in type: lldb_private::OperatingSystem. The operating system
2011-08-22 02:49:39 +00:00
RegisterValue.cpp
Fix a logic error caught by the static analyzer.
2011-08-12 01:22:56 +00:00
RegularExpression.cpp
Add a new breakpoint type "break by source regular expression".
2011-09-21 01:17:13 +00:00
Scalar.cpp
Fix a logic error caught by the static analyzer.
2011-08-11 19:12:10 +00:00
SearchFilter.cpp
Added the ability to restrict breakpoints by function name, function regexp, selector
2011-09-23 00:54:11 +00:00
Section.cpp
Moved lldb::user_id_t values to be 64 bit. This was going to be needed for
2011-10-19 18:09:39 +00:00
SourceManager.cpp
Added ClangNamespaceDecl * parameters to several
2011-10-12 02:08:07 +00:00
State.cpp
Centralized all of the format to c-string and to format character code inside
2011-06-23 21:22:24 +00:00
Stream.cpp
Use Host::File in lldb_private::StreamFile and other places to cleanup host
2011-02-09 01:08:52 +00:00
StreamAsynchronousIO.cpp
This patch captures and serializes all output being written by the
2011-05-02 20:41:46 +00:00
StreamFile.cpp
Use Host::File in lldb_private::StreamFile and other places to cleanup host
2011-02-09 01:08:52 +00:00
StreamString.cpp
Completed more work on the KDP darwin kernel debugging Process plug-in.
2011-07-16 03:19:08 +00:00
StringList.cpp
While tracking down memory consumption issue a few things were needed: the
2011-08-10 02:10:13 +00:00
Timer.cpp
Added a setting to "log timer" so you can see the incremental timings as well:
2010-11-04 23:19:21 +00:00
UUID.cpp
Header patch, virtual dtor patch and missed UUID patch from Kirk Beitz.
2011-02-05 02:56:16 +00:00
UserID.cpp
Moved lldb::user_id_t values to be 64 bit. This was going to be needed for
2011-10-19 18:09:39 +00:00
UserSettingsController.cpp
Re-organized the contents of RangeMap.h to be more concise and also allow for a Range, RangeArray, RangeData (range + data), or a RangeDataArray. We have many range implementations in LLDB and I will be converting over to using the classes in RangeMap.h so we can have one set of code that does ranges and searching of ranges.
2011-10-07 18:58:12 +00:00
VMRange.cpp
Added support for inlined stack frames being represented as real stack frames
2010-08-24 00:45:41 +00:00
Value.cpp
Converted the lldb_private::Process over to use the intrusive
2011-09-22 04:58:26 +00:00
ValueObject.cpp
Stop empty C strings in summaries from showing "<data not available>" when a
2011-10-05 22:19:51 +00:00
ValueObjectChild.cpp
Redesign of the interaction between Python and frozen objects:
2011-09-06 19:20:51 +00:00
ValueObjectConstResult.cpp
Redesign of the interaction between Python and frozen objects:
2011-09-06 19:20:51 +00:00
ValueObjectConstResultChild.cpp
Redesign of the interaction between Python and frozen objects:
2011-09-06 19:20:51 +00:00
ValueObjectConstResultImpl.cpp
Redesign of the interaction between Python and frozen objects:
2011-09-06 19:20:51 +00:00
ValueObjectDynamicValue.cpp
Converted the lldb_private::Process over to use the intrusive
2011-09-22 04:58:26 +00:00
ValueObjectList.cpp
Added the ability to see global variables with a variable expression path so
2011-07-08 21:46:14 +00:00
ValueObjectMemory.cpp
Converted the lldb_private::Process over to use the intrusive
2011-09-22 04:58:26 +00:00
ValueObjectRegister.cpp
Fixed register value objects to be able to return their values as unsigned
2011-08-16 03:49:01 +00:00
ValueObjectSyntheticFilter.cpp
- Now using ${var} as the summary for an aggregate type will produce "name-of-type @ object-location" instead of giving an error
2011-08-19 21:13:46 +00:00
ValueObjectVariable.cpp
Fixed an issue where a variable whose value is in a register might end up
2011-10-01 01:53:20 +00:00